Aji Verde (Peruvian Green Sauce) First Image

Creamy Serrano Pepper Sauce

  • Total Time: 10 minutes
  • Yield: 2 cups 1x

Description

A delicious and creamy sauce made with fresh ingredients, perfect for enhancing your dishes.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 whole lime (juiced)
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1/2 cup good-quality mayonnaise (such as Hellmann’s)
  • 3 ounces queso fresco or blanco
  • 2 serrano peppers (ends trimmed)
  • 1 bunch cilantro (with the leaves removed and stems discarded)
  • 4 cloves garlic (peeled)
  • 2 green onions (ends trimmed and roughly chopped)
  • 1 tablespoon aji amarillo paste (optional)
  • 1/4 teaspoon kosher salt

Instructions

  1. To a blender, add the lime juice, olive oil, cheese, mayonnaise, serrano peppers, cilantro leaves, garlic cloves, green onions, aji amarillo and salt.
  2. Blend for about 1 to 2 minutes, until very smooth. At first the cilantro leaves won’t be totally smooth, but keep the blender running and it will eventually become cohesive and smooth.
  3. Give it a taste and adjust the salt according to your liking.
  4. Keeps in the fridge for up to a week.

Notes

  • This sauce pairs well with grilled meats, tacos, or as a dip.
  • Adjust the amount of serrano peppers based on your heat preference.
